Abstract:

The focus of this paper is to find a new method analyzing the reasons of CNC machine tool precision recession. The modeling of the movement error of CNC machine tool is one of the most important problem for kinematics designing and accuracy analysis. In this dissertation, this study analyzes the six movement error parameters of guide and the model of the guide which including foundation deformation, material's natural ageing and way rub has been established. A detailed example is given for the modeling precision recession of 3-axis CNC machine tool.
